About The Book
Every instinct tells him to run. Every memory tells him he can’t.
Special Agent Daniel Stansfield is ready for a change. Burnt out and defeated by the job, it’s his last day with the FBI. But before he can turn in his badge, he’s summoned back to Denver, the city he ran from four years ago, with a chilling message: it's happening again.
Seemingly innocent people are waking up on the side of the highway, with no memory of how they got there, wearing the skin of victims they've allegedly never met. And they each share one haunting detail: a strand of a stranger’s hair is tied around their tongue.
Now Daniel is pulled back into the gruesome cycle, and every clue leads him deeper into the shadows of his own past. He will have to confront the ghosts of his traumatic childhood and face what’s been hunting him all along— before he and the people he loves become the next victims.
About The Author
CJ LEEDE is a horror writer, hiker, and Trekkie. She is the author of Maeve Fly and American Rapture. Her debut novel Maeve Fly won the Golden Poppy Octavia E. Butler Award and Splatterpunk Award, and earned a Bram Stoker Award nomination. When she is not driving around the country, CJ can be found in LA with her boyfriend and rescue dogs.
About The Moderator
Victoria Menendez is part of the Horror Readers Team at Books & Books. Born and raised in Miami, Victoria read Frankenstein at the young age of 13, and was forever inducted into the horror club. When she's not being possessed by Madame V, the devilish host of the annual Books & Books horror writers event, The Grim Gables, reading and reviewing terrifying books on her Instagram @victoria_readsstuff, writing horror stories about puberty demons and vampire break ups, or taking care of her howling sidekick Ruby, she's running amok at Books & Books recommending as many underrated spooky books as she can.
